New style roundels fitted...

Just got a new set of roundels for the M. The older style with the grey plastic ring round the edge soon look rubbish as they let the water in behind the badge after a while (jet washing, etc...)



Look much smarter as they fill the whole hole fully, if that makes sence ?!



Not sure if theae are standard fit now ???
